Plot Summary
Set in the fictional gritty South Manchester estate of Chatsworth, the series follows the dysfunctional Gallagher family, led by the irresponsible Frank Gallagher. His children largely raise themselves, navigating poverty, crime, and social services with a unique blend of resilience and chaos. The show explores their often absurd and heartbreaking attempts to survive and find happiness amidst dire circumstances.
Critical Reception
The original UK 'Shameless' was widely acclaimed for its raw portrayal of working-class life, its dark humor, and its challenging social commentary. It was praised for its unflinching honesty and compelling characters, though some found its bleakness and depiction of social issues confronting.
What Reviewers Say
- Praised for its authentic and gritty depiction of poverty and dysfunction.
- Lauded for its dark humor and often shocking storylines.
- Noted for strong performances, particularly from David Threlfall as Frank Gallagher.
